Red Hat Identity Management vs 389 Directory Server: Biggest differences
Start here before you go deeper into features.
Best for centralized Linux identity and access management in enterprises.
- You need centralized management of Linux identities and policies.
- Your environment is predominantly Linux-based requiring deep OS integration.
- You require enterprise-grade security and authentication controls tailored for Linux.
- Your infrastructure includes multiple operating systems beyond Linux.
- You lack specialized Linux IT security resources due to complex setup.
Best for scalable, secure enterprise LDAP directory services.
- You need a robust, scalable LDAP server for enterprise identity management.
- Your IT team can handle complex setup and ongoing maintenance.
- You require strong security features backed by a reputable vendor like Red Hat.
- You are a small organization without dedicated IT or security staff.
- You prefer simple, out-of-the-box cloud identity management solutions.
